Tonight my friends and I were playing CBT on tabletop. We use the 3-D hexes from HeroScape for a better map, and we began. The story was we were Davion vs Steiner immediately after the split, and that we had been cut off by the Clans. Davion hired mercs, Steiner hired pirates, and away we go. My team (Davion) raced a lance of light/medium mechs into the Steiner City ASAP for a scout run. Our Units: 1 PHX 1K 1 FFL 4A 1 PNT 1 Hollander
We immediately discovered: 1 100 ton custom (pirate) 1 Stone Rhino 1 LongBow 1 Catapult 3 Mars XL Tanks (100 tons)
Now, as you can see, we are about to die. I tell my fellow teammate "We shoot ONE round, all at a tank, and then we leave!" Movement and firing begins, and this is where all hell breaks loose.
Our opponent has spaced the mechs 2 hexes apart in a staggered line with the order being shown left to right as above from top to bottom. The three Mars tanks were on the ground 1 elevation down and 1 in front of the mechs. We killed a single tank and waited for the pain.
Both remaining tanks ammo boomed right away. The Custom ammo popped on the first shot (his AC jammed) The Stone Rhino headcapped the Firefly, legged the Hollander, and crippled the Panther. The Longbow ammo popped HIS first LRM 15 shot . . . . . . and so did the Catapult.
When the Stackpole-driven dust settled, The PHX1K had a head hit from debris, the Panther was down but not out, and we had control of the main city.
We did NOT keep it (2 lances of tanks and mechs were inbound), but we got some sweet salvage.
